How Streaming is Reshaping Asian Media
Streaming platforms are profoundly altering the panorama of Asian media. Previously, reliant on linear networks and movie houses, the region is now experiencing a surge in domestic content creation, fueled by worldwide streaming giants like copyright, Disney+, and developing Asian platforms. This shift has empowered independent filmmakers and producers, allowing them to reach larger audiences beyond national borders.

The Rise of Local Content on Asian Streaming Platforms
The expansion of internet entertainment providers across Asia has sparked a remarkable revolution towards domestic content. Previously, many networks focused on purchasing foreign movies, but a rising demand from audiences for genuine traditional stories is pushing a boom in new Asian productions. This trend advantages both budding producers and larger media players, generating a vibrant and challenging market for Asian storytelling.
